Instead of producing a stainless tank to make room for insulation, etc. as
well as reducing the volume of the tank, have you considered installing a
fuel radiator on the return line? Summit Racing has a dual pass radiator
meant for this purpose. I have thought about using this myself, but like
yourself, I am up to my throat with projects. I do not think that
installing this would be too difficult other than locating a place to
install it. You will obviously not install it behind the water radiator, so
it would be necessary to locate a place where "clean" air could be easily
directed to the cooling fins. This would allow you to not mess with
fabricating a new tank, reducing the volume, and screwing with insulating
everything. Just a thought.
